These are the most important privacy settings in iOS 9

The minute you download and install iOS 9, the latest version of Apple's mobile operating system, you should take note of these privacy and security steps to lock down your device.

iOS 9 comes with a number of security and privacy improvements. Before you do anything like customizing your phone, loading new apps, or syncing your data for the first time, these settings need to be checked -- and if necessary, changed.
